basic shortcrust pastry

  • 2 cups (300g) plain (all-purpose) flour 
  • 145g butter 
  • 2–3 tablespoons iced water
  1. Process the flour and butter in a food processor until the mixture resembles fine breadcrumbs. While the motor is running, add enough iced water to form a smooth dough. Knead very lightly then wrap the d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ate for 30 minutes. 
  2. When ready to use, roll out on a lightly floured surface until 3mm (1/8 in) thick. Makes 350g (12 oz), which will line up to a 25cm (10 in) pie dish or tart tin.baking blind

To bake blind – to produce a crisp tart shell ready to be filled with wet ingredients – top the pastry-lined tart tin or tins with a piece of non-stick baking paper that extends past the edge of the tin. Fill with pastry weights or uncooked rice or beans. Place on a baking tray and bake in a preheated 180°C (350°F) oven for 10 minutes. Remove the weights and paper and bake for a further 5 minutes or until the pastry is golden.
